Token

Date: 
1900-1930
Medium: 
Metal
Dimensions: 
1 1/4 in. diameter
Description: 
This token reads on one side "Kasner & Co. Brooklyn's Leading Tailors 459 Fulton St./ The Place To Get Good Fitting Clothes and Right Up To The Minute on Style". On the back are the words "Membership Emblem of the Don't Worry Club/ Good Luck" and symbols of luck including a horseshoe, wishbone and a large swastika- indicating that this was produced before the 1930's when swastikas were considered an ancient symbol of fortune and not yet associated with Nazi Germany.

Box/ Food

Date: 
1900-1920
Medium: 
Paper
Dimensions: 
2 3/4 x 2 x 1 in.
Description: 
This tiny brown box held a sample of cereal. It reads on the front "Fully Cooked, Pre-Digested, Breakfast Food/ Grape-Nuts/ A food for the brain and nerve centres....". The box text attributes many pseudoscientific health benefits to the product. The back has directions for preparation.
